Competitive salaries is only solution of problem of lack of workforce – Poroshenko
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ko has urged employers to offer competitive salaries, as this is the only way to solve the problem of a lack of workforce in Ukraine.
"At my regular meetings with the government and law enforcement agencies, with business associations, employers are increasingly complaining about labor shortages, not the pressure. No one will impose the iron curtain on the border, as in the Soviet era. Dear employers, there is one way out: increase wages," Poroshenko said from the parliamentary rostrum, speaking with an annual message on Thursday.
Ukraine is becoming part of the single labor market, which means competition, he said.
"If you want the Ukrainians not to go abroad, but work for us, you have to be competitive in the salary market," the president said.
